Plot Summary

In the distant future of the 31st century, the galaxy is plagued by galactic lawbreakers. To combat this menace, Commander Walsh sets up the SilverHawks, a team of cyborg law enforcement officers. The team consists of Quicksilver, who is the leader, Tally-Hawk, a native birdman, Steelheart, a metallic woman, and his pilot, Bluegrass. They are assisted by a robot armadillo named Sidewinder and a telepathic monkey named Op. Together, they patrol the galaxy, protecting the innocent from space pirates led by Mon.*

Fun Fact

SilverHawks was created by the same team behind the popular "ThunderCats" series, with many of the same animators and writers working on both shows.
